How to solve “Component disconnected” error in DesignBuilder for Fan Coil Unit and Zone Group?

Hi,

I’m modeling a data center baseline in DesignBuilder v7.3 and get this error:

Building 1 – Component disconnected: BLOCK1:SERVERHALL Fan Coil Unit
Building 1 – Component disconnected: Zone Group
Building 1 – Error in HVAC definition

Setup summary:

CHW loop with chiller and condenser loop with cooling tower.

Office-Control zone: FCU connected to CHW loop.

Server Hall zone: also FCU (currently).

UPS-Service zone: separate system (PTAC).

Zone group created for Office + Server Hall.

Everything looks connected, but simulation fails with these disconnection errors.

👉 Should the Server Hall use a Water-to-Air Heat Pump linked to the Condenser Loop instead of FCU? Or is there another common cause for this issue?

Thanks!

Hi,

This message is displayed because the Heating water coils are not connected to the plant loop.
